Age Limit (as on 01/07/2026)
Candidates must have attained the age of 21 years and must not have crossed the age of 40 years. For Principal posts, the age should be between 30 and 40 years.

UPPSC PCS 2026 Application Fee
The category-wise online application fee for the Combined State / Upper Subordinate Services Examination-2026 is mentioned below:
| Category | Total Fee |
| General/ OBC / EWS | Exam fee Rs. 100/- + Online processing fee Rs. 25/-, Total Rs. 125/- |
| SC/ST | Exam fee Rs. 40/- + On-line processing fee Rs. 25/-, Total = Rs. 65/- |
| Differently Abled Person | Exam fee NIL+ On-line processing fee Rs. 25/- Total = Rs. 25/- |
| Ex-Serviceman | Exam fee Rs. 40/- + On-line processing fee Rs. 25/- Total = Rs. 65/- |
| Dependents of the Freedom Fighters/Women | According to their original category |
UPPSC 2026 Selection Process
UPPSC 2026 PCS selection procedure has 3 stages:
- Preliminary Examination (Objective Type & Multiple Choice)
- Main Examination (Conventional Type, i.e., Written examination)
- Viva-Voce (Personality Test)
UPPSC 2026 Exam Pattern
The UPPSC PCS exam is a three-stage exam, and the candidates need to appear in the UPPSC PCS prelims exam followed by the mains exam & Interview (Personality Test).
Prelims Exam Pattern
- The Prelims exam of UPPSC PCS 2026 is an offline mode of examination, with 2 papers in different shifts
- The total marks allotted for each paper is 200, and the total time allotted for the completion of each Paper of the Prelims exam is 2 hours
- The total number of questions in Paper-1 (General Studies I) is 150, while Paper-2 is of 100 marks.
| Papers | Total Questions | Marks | Duration |
| Paper-1 – General Studies I | 150 | 200 marks | 2 Hours |
| Paper-2 – General Studies II (CSAT) Qualifying in Nature |
100 | 200 marks | 2 Hours |
Important Points:
- Paper II of the Preliminary Examination will be a qualifying paper with a minimum qualifying mark fixed at 33%
- The Candidates must appear in both papers of the Preliminary Examination
- The merit of the Candidates will be determined based on the marks obtained in Paper I of the Preliminary Examination.
Mains Exam Pattern
The UPPSC PCS mains written examination will consist of six compulsory and two optional Papers. The time allotted for each paper is 3 hours. The Pattern & and syllabus for the main examination is provided below:
| Paper Name | Marks | Time Duration |
| General Hindi | 150 | 3 Hours |
| Essay | 150 | 3 Hours |
| General Studies – I | 200 | 3 Hours |
| General Studies – II | 200 | 3 Hours |
| General Studies – III | 200 | 3 Hours |
| General Studies – IV | 200 | 3 Hours |
| Optional Subject – Paper I | 200 | 3 Hours |
| Optional Subject – Paper II | 200 | 3 Hours |
Personality Test (Interview)
The Personality Test (VIVA-VOCE) will constitute 100 marks. The test will relate to the matter of general interest, keeping the matter of academic interest in view, and for general awareness, intelligence, character, expression power/personality, general suitability for the service, some general knowledge questions, and current topics.
